当前位置:首页 > 行业动态 > 正文

易语言如何高效整合MySQL数据库资源?

MySQL数据库与易语言的结合

易语言如何高效整合MySQL数据库资源?  第1张

1. 简介

MySQL是一款开源的关系型数据库管理系统,而易语言是一种面向中文用户的编程语言,将MySQL数据库与易语言结合,可以实现数据库的查询、操作等功能,为易语言开发者提供强大的数据支持。

2. 易语言访问MySQL数据库的方法

易语言访问MySQL数据库通常需要以下步骤:

2.1 安装MySQL数据库驱动

需要在易语言开发环境中安装MySQL数据库驱动,MySQL Connector/C”或“MySQL Connector/ODBC”。

2.2 配置数据库连接

在易语言中,通过编写代码来配置数据库连接,以下是一个示例代码片段:

连接句柄 = 数据库连接("数据库服务器地址", "用户名", "密码", "数据库名", "数据库类型")

2.3 执行数据库操作

连接成功后,可以通过以下方法执行数据库操作:

查询:使用SQL语句进行查询。

“`e

查询结果集 = 执行SQL查询(连接句柄, "SELECT * FROM 表名")

“`

插入:使用SQL语句进行插入操作。

“`e

执行SQL(连接句柄, "INSERT INTO 表名 (字段1, 字段2) VALUES (值1, 值2)")

“`

更新:使用SQL语句进行更新操作。

“`e

执行SQL(连接句柄, "UPDATE 表名 SET 字段1 = 值1 WHERE 条件")

“`

删除:使用SQL语句进行删除操作。

“`e

执行SQL(连接句柄, "DELETE FROM 表名 WHERE 条件")

“`

3. 示例代码

以下是一个简单的易语言代码示例,用于连接MySQL数据库并查询数据:

.版本 2
.程序集 MysqlExample
.子程序 主程序
  数据库句柄 = 数据库连接("127.0.0.1", "root", "password", "testdb", "MySQL")
  查询结果集 = 执行SQL查询(数据库句柄, "SELECT * FROM users")
  .循环
    .查询结果集.读取数据()
      输出 查询结果集.字段("username") + " " + 查询结果集.字段("email")
    .结束如果
  .结束循环
  数据库连接关闭(数据库句柄)

4. 注意事项

确保MySQL数据库驱动与易语言版本兼容。

注意SQL语句的编写规范,避免SQL注入等安全问题。

优化数据库连接,避免频繁打开和关闭连接。

0